Join Sarah Williams at Devonport Library for this free Love Food Hate Waste Workshop – peels, pulp and stems.
These are parts of fruit and vegetables that are usually thrown away or composted but are often edible. This would suit those who are already on their food waste reduction journey and want to learn more as well as those new to the subject. We’ll get hands on and explore some techniques that can easily be replicated at home.
The workshop will also cover practical advice on how to avoid food waste in the kitchen including meal planning and how to store fresh produce to help it last longer.
This Love Food Hate Waste workshop is proudly supported by Auckland Council, Devonport Library and is delivered by Compost Collective.
